No word of fiance

(N.Z. Press Association)

WELLINGTON, Dec. 30. The Indian fiance of a New Zealand-born Indian girl was still waiting tonight for news about her disappearance. Miss Parvati Kala, aged 18, has not been seen by her parents since she left home in Lower Hutt about 1 p.m. on Monday. She is due to marry Mr Mavindra Bhana, aged 21 a diamond cutter from Bombay, on Monday. Mr Bhana has been granted a permit to stay in New Zealand until January 7, and he plans to settle in this country after his marriage. Mr Bhana’s cousins m Lower Hutt said tonight there had been no news of the whereabouts of Miss Kala since Monday.
